Wylie interiors split neatly in two. In the newer subdivisions it is builder-grade flat white waiting to become something with personality. Near Olde City and the historic downtown streets it is older homes with real character, older trim, and walls that need a more careful hand. We do both, and we quote them differently because they genuinely are different jobs.
In a new Wylie build the opportunity is color and finish quality: two proper coats, a washable sheen where it matters, and a palette that makes a production floor plan feel like yours. Prep is minimal and the job moves fast.
In an older downtown Wylie home the priority flips to prep — settling cracks, patched texture, layered trim, and the occasional surprise behind a wall. We spend the time there because on an older home that is what determines whether the finish still looks right in three years.

Wylie is full of young families. Hallways, playrooms, and stairwells get a scrubbable sheen that survives handprints.
A repaint that skips the ceiling often makes the ceiling look worse by comparison. We will tell you when that is going to happen.
We work room by room, cover and center your furniture, and reassemble each evening. No moving out.
Interior painting in Wylie runs about $300 to $700 per room and roughly $2,000 to $5,000 for a full interior. Newer subdivision homes tend toward the lower end; older homes near downtown sit higher because of the extra prep.

Yes. Older downtown homes get the careful prep they need — properly floated cracks, matched texture on repairs, and trim sanded back rather than painted thicker. It takes longer, and we price it honestly.
Typically $300 to $700 per room, or roughly $2,000 to $5,000 for a full interior. New builds usually land at the lower end since prep is minimal — the money goes into product and coats instead of repairs.
A full interior in a typical Wylie home is 3 to 6 working days. Older downtown homes can run longer depending on how much wall repair is needed.
Ideally we paint before the furniture arrives — it is faster, cleaner, and cheaper for you. If you are already in, that is fine too; we just work room by room around you.
Wylie has grown faster than almost anywhere in the area, and that growth created a very specific situation: thousands of homes in Bozman Farms, Inspiration, Braddock Place, and the Lake Lavon subdivisions all built within a few years of each other, all painted with builder-grade exterior at the same time — and all hitting the 5-to-7-year mark where that original coating starts to chalk and fail together..
